    Abstract: An escalator comprising four kinds of steps is disclosed. The first steps are ordinary steps, and the second step is disposed between the first steps and has a retractable support device for supporting a vertically movable step of the third step. The movable step supported by the support device lifts from the third step as the steps ascend to provide a deeper effective tread together with the tread of the second step. The fourth step includes a drop-down step which can be moved into a sloped position which also provides a space for safely accommodating a wheelchair or the like on the deep effective tread thus provided by the second, third, and fourth steps.

    Abstract: A moving staircase is disclosed wherein along the circulating path of a number of conventional tread boards thereof which are articulated together in an endless fashion at least one pair of specifically constituted tread boards are disposed between any two conventional tread boards so as to be articulated thereto. The specifically constituted tread boards each have substantially the same configuration as that of the conventional tread board and are articulated one behind the other in the circulating direction of the conventional tread boards. The rear one is provided with a movable footboard so as to be moved up and down relative thereto, the movable footboard being adapted to be normally locked to the rear one of the specifically constituted tread boards by a lock means provided therein.

    Abstract: The semiconductor device comprises a semiconductor substrate, a polycrystalline silicon semiconductor body extending upwardly from a portion of the surface of the semiconductor substrate and containing an impurity at a substantially uniform concentration, and a metal electrode disposed on the top surface of the polycrystalline silicon semiconductor body. The metal electrode extends in the lateral direction beyond the periphery of the top surface of the polycrystalline silicon semiconductor body.

    Abstract: The disclosed safety devices are disposed at either of the edges of each stair of an escalator. Each device includes a sensor dovetailed to a bracket for the individual stair treads and risers to abut against and be horizontally aligned with a displacement element screwed to the bracket. The sensor of each device projects beyond a corresponding riser. If a passenger's calf or the like contacts the sensor, the latter retrogrades to displace the abutting end portion of the displacement element toward the adjacent skirt plate of the escalator to narrow a space formed between the displacement element and the skirt plate. The sensor may be disposed in a vertically aligned, abutting relationship upon the displacement element to somewhat project beyond the cleats on a tread.
